Crane Services & Equipment Rental Throughout the Northwest Since 1996
Inland Crane Inc operates from Boise, Oregon, providing specialized crane and material handling services to large and small projects across the Northwest. The company has served both residential and commercial clients for over 25 years with a focus on safety and professional service delivery.
Services:
- Hydraulic crane services
- Conventional crane services
- Crawler crane services
- Rough terrain crane services
- Tower crane services
- Personnel and material hoist services
- Machinery moving
- Bare equipment rental

Before You Hire
- Confirm the license is Active and hasn't expired.
- Check that bond and insurance are current - dates are listed above. Bond and insurance cover different risks →
- Confirm the RMI (Responsible Managing Individual) will be on-site.
- Always get a written contract referencing CCB license #114951.
- Cross-verify with the official CCB database - data here may have a delay.
- CCB Lookup does not include complaint or disciplinary history. For complaint records, check the official CCB search →
